Bug Description

I upgraded a machine from Kubuntu 22.04 to 23.10 and then immediately to 23.04. After logging on to 23.04 I tried to open LibreOffice documents but only had a vertical line on the screen. After some experimentation I found that this line was a window of zero width and it was possible to use the mouse to widen to a usable window. Opening subsequent documents was OK.

I have now recreated this on VirtualBox and it seems that the problem occurs if you don't edit documents at the 23.10 stage. Steps to recreate.

1. Install Kubuntu 22.04, run apt update/dist-upgrade.
2. Close, take snapshot, reload
3. Create LibreOffice documents, eg calc, impress and write, enter random text.
4. Close, take snapshot, reload
5. Upgrade to 22.10
6. Close, take snapshot, reload
7. Log on, edit each document, add more random text.
8. Close, take snapshot, reload
9. Upgrade to 23.04
10. Close, take snapshot, reload
11. Log on and open documents

Following the above script which includes document updates under 22.10, the documents open correctly in 23.04.

Repeat the above, omitting steps 7 & 8 so the documents aren't edited under 22.10. The documents open as a zero width window in 23.04.
